Bocelli got his first top 10 on the album sales chart in 1999 with Dream, which debuted and peaked at No.4. He landed his first No.1 with 2018 And.

During his career, Bocelli sold 24.3 million albums in the United States Believe also gives Bocelli his 20th No.1 on the Classic Albums chart and his 14th No.1 on the Classic Crossover Albums chart. He extends his own record for the most # 1 albums on both charts.

The Classical Albums ranks the most popular classic albums of the week based on multi-metric consumption, combining album sales, album units equivalent to tracks, and streaming equivalent album units. The Classical Crossover Albums table ranks the best-selling classic crossover titles of the week.

Back in the top 10 of new album sales list, AC / DC’s Power Up debuted at No. 1 with 111,000 copies sold. As previously reported, the album also enters No. 1 on the Billboard 200 for multi-metric consumption – the group’s first No. 1 since 2008.

Chris Stapleton’s last effort Restart starts at # 2 with 75,000 copies sold, while Queen’s The biggest hits exploded 46-3 (a new peak) with 24,000 sold (+ 737%) – its best sales week since 2007. The bulk of the latter’s sales (23,000 in fact) came from LP vinyl sales, in largely thanks to a Walmart sale where all vinyl in-store on Nov. 14 was reduced to $ 15. The biggest hits, which was originally released in 1981, also reached the top 10 on the Billboard 200 for the first time.

The biggest hits records its best selling week since the chart dated December 8, 2007, when it sold 36,000 copies (in the follow-up week ending November 25 – which reflected the Thanksgiving and Black Friday shopping holidays of this year).

Dolly parton A Christmas Holly Dolly returned to its peak of No. 4 on album sales, as it gained two places with 21,000 copies sold (up 90%).

Fleetwood Mac’s Rumors jumped 18-6 with 17,000 sold (up 261%), with LP vinyl sales accounting for 16,000 of that sum (up 369%). Rumors also benefited from Walmart’s $ 15 selling price. Rumors Reached for the first time the top 10 of the album sales chart (whose history dates back to May 25, 1991) and marks the group’s first top 10 since the 2003 album Say you want started and peaked at # 3 (chart dated May 3, 2003). Rumors It also has its best sales week since the chart dated May 21, 2011, when it sold 30,000 copies following the premiere of the Joy TV episode dedicated to the album (May 3).

Carrie Underwood Vacation Set My present is pushed back 3-7 on the new chart of album sales, but shows a gain, as it sold just under 17,000 copies (up 17%).

Pentatonix’s latest holiday album We need a little Christmas fell to No. 8 with 16,000 sold. This is the 11th top 10 of the vocal group. Of those 11 top 10s, six were Christmas headlines.

Bob Marley and the Wailers’ Caption: The best of … vaults 48-9 with 15,500 sold (up 453%). It was also praised by Walmart vinyl sales, with the title having sold nearly 15,000 vinyl records (up 639%).

Legend records its best overall sales week since the chart dated September 20, 2014, when the album sold 41,000 copies after being reduced to 99 cents on the Google Play Store.

Closing the new top 10 on the album sales chart is another title getting a boost from Walmart, like Creedence Clearwater Revival’s Column: The 20 greatest hits rises 59-10 with 14,000 copies sold (+ 485%). Of this amount, 13,000 are LP vinyl sales (+ 776%). the Chronicle has its best sales week since the chart dated August 17, 2013, when it moved 15,000 copies.
